This page is part of the FHIR Specification (v3.3.0: R4 Ballot 2). The current version which supercedes this version is 5.0.0. For a full list of available versions, see the Directory of published versions
Public Health and Emergency Response Work Group | Maturity Level: 0 | Draft | Compartments: Patient |
Detailed Descriptions for the elements in the OccupationalData resource.
OccupationalData | |
Element Id | OccupationalData |
Definition | A person's work information, structured to facilitate individual, population, and public health use; not intended to support billing. |
Control | 1..1 |
OccupationalData.identifier | |
Element Id | OccupationalData.identifier |
Definition | Business identifier assigned to the occupational data record. |
Note | This is a business identifer, not a resource identifier (see discussion) |
Control | 0..1 |
Type | Identifier |
OccupationalData.status | |
Element Id | OccupationalData.status |
Definition | The status of this ODH. Enables tracking the life-cycle of the content. |
Control | 1..1 |
Terminology Binding | PublicationStatus (Required) |
Type | code |
Is Modifier | true (Reason: This element is labeled as a modifier because it is a status element that contains status entered-in-error which means that the resource should not be treated as valid) |
Summary | true |
Comments | Allows filtering of {{titles}} that are appropriate for use vs. not. |
OccupationalData.subject | |
Element Id | OccupationalData.subject |
Definition | The occupational data record is about this person (e.g., the patient, a parent of a minor child). |
Control | 0..1 |
Type | Reference(Patient | RelatedPerson) |
Summary | true |
OccupationalData.date | |
Element Id | OccupationalData.date |
Definition | The date of creation or updating of the occupational data record. |
Control | 0..1 |
Type | dateTime |
OccupationalData.recorder | |
Element Id | OccupationalData.recorder |
Definition | The person who created or last updated the occupational data record. |
Control | 0..* |
Type | Reference(Practitioner | PractitionerRole | Patient | RelatedPerson) |
OccupationalData.informant | |
Element Id | OccupationalData.informant |
Definition | The person who provided the subject's health-related occupational data. |
Control | 0..* |
Type | Reference(Patient | RelatedPerson) |
OccupationalData.employmentStatus | |
Element Id | OccupationalData.employmentStatus |
Definition | A person's current economic relationship to a job. Employment status refers to whether a person is currently working for compensation, is unemployed (i.e., searching for work for compensation), or is not in the labor force (e.g. disabled, homemaker, chooses not to work, etc.). Employment status is not the same as classification of work. |
Control | 0..* |
Summary | true |
OccupationalData.employmentStatus.code | |
Element Id | OccupationalData.employmentStatus.code |
Definition | A code that represents a person's current economic relationship to a job. |
Control | 1..1 |
Terminology Binding | Employment Status (ODH) (Example) |
Type | CodeableConcept |
Summary | true |
OccupationalData.employmentStatus.effective | |
Element Id | OccupationalData.employmentStatus.effective |
Definition | The start and end dates for a person's current economic relationship to a job. |
Control | 1..1 |
Type | Period |
Summary | true |
OccupationalData.retirementDate | |
Element Id | OccupationalData.retirementDate |
Definition | A person's self-identified retirement date. A person may retire multiple times. |
Control | 0..* |
Type | dateTime |
Summary | true |
OccupationalData.combatZonePeriod | |
Element Id | OccupationalData.combatZonePeriod |
Definition | The start and end dates for the period of time a person's work is or was in a combat zone. In addition to military personnel, civilians also may work or have worked in a combat zone. |
Control | 0..* |
Type | Period |
Summary | true |
OccupationalData.usualWork | |
Element Id | OccupationalData.usualWork |
Definition | The type of work a person has held for the longest amount of time during his or her life, regardless of the occupation currently held and regardless of whether or not it has been held for a continuous time. |
Control | 0..1 |
Summary | true |
OccupationalData.usualWork.occupation | |
Element Id | OccupationalData.usualWork.occupation |
Definition | A code that represents the type of work a person has held for the longest amount of time during his or her life. |
Control | 1..1 |
Terminology Binding | Occupation CDC Census 2010 (Example) |
Type | CodeableConcept |
Summary | true |
OccupationalData.usualWork.industry | |
Element Id | OccupationalData.usualWork.industry |
Definition | A code that represents the type of business a person has worked in for the longest total time while in the usual occupation. |
Control | 1..1 |
Terminology Binding | Industry CDC Census 2010 (Example) |
Type | CodeableConcept |
Summary | true |
OccupationalData.usualWork.start | |
Element Id | OccupationalData.usualWork.start |
Definition | The date when a person first started working in their usual occupation. |
Control | 0..1 |
Type | dateTime |
Summary | true |
OccupationalData.usualWork.duration | |
Element Id | OccupationalData.usualWork.duration |
Definition | Total of all periods of time a person has spent in the usual occupation, not including intermittent period(s) where the person was not working in that occupation. |
Control | 0..1 |
Type | Duration |
Summary | true |
Comments | The duration value is generally recorded in years. |
OccupationalData.pastOrPresentJob | |
Element Id | OccupationalData.pastOrPresentJob |
Definition | The type of work done by a person during a current or past job. A job is defined by the sum of all the data related to the occupation. A change in occupation, supervisory level, industry, employer, or employer location is considered a new job. |
Control | 0..* |
Summary | true |
OccupationalData.pastOrPresentJob.occupation | |
Element Id | OccupationalData.pastOrPresentJob.occupation |
Definition | A code that represents the type of work done by a person at one job. |
Control | 1..1 |
Terminology Binding | Occupation CDC Census 2010 (Example) |
Type | CodeableConcept |
Summary | true |
OccupationalData.pastOrPresentJob.industry | |
Element Id | OccupationalData.pastOrPresentJob.industry |
Definition | A code that represents the type of business associated with a person's Past or Present Job; i.e., for one job. A change in industry indicates a change in job. |
Control | 1..1 |
Terminology Binding | Industry CDC Census 2010 (Example) |
Type | CodeableConcept |
Summary | true |
OccupationalData.pastOrPresentJob.effective | |
Element Id | OccupationalData.pastOrPresentJob.effective |
Definition | The start and end dates for one job. A change in occupation, supervisory level, industry, employer, or employer location is considered a new job. |
Control | 0..1 |
Type | Period |
Summary | true |
OccupationalData.pastOrPresentJob.employer | |
Element Id | OccupationalData.pastOrPresentJob.employer |
Definition | The party, be it an individual or an organization, responsible for providing compensation to a person performing work, or in the case of unpaid work, the party responsible for engaging the person in a position. For military occupations, this refers to the name of the person's military home base; the person's Branch of Service is recorded as industry. A change in employer or employer location indicates a change in job. |
Control | 0..1 |
Type | Reference(Organization) |
Summary | true |
OccupationalData.pastOrPresentJob.workClassification | |
Element Id | OccupationalData.pastOrPresentJob.workClassification |
Definition | The classification of a person's job (one job) as defined by compensation and sector (e.g. paid, unpaid, self-employed, government, etc.). This is different from employment status: a person who is a volunteer (work classification) may have chosen not to be in the labor force (employment status). |
Control | 0..1 |
Terminology Binding | Work Classification (ODH) (Example) |
Type | CodeableConcept |
Summary | true |
OccupationalData.pastOrPresentJob.supervisoryLevel | |
Element Id | OccupationalData.pastOrPresentJob.supervisoryLevel |
Definition | Reflects the amount of supervisory or management responsibilities of a person at one job. For military jobs, pay grade is used as a proxy because it can be interpreted across branches of service. A change in supervisory level is considered a new job. |
Control | 0..1 |
Terminology Binding | Supervisory Level (ODH) (US) (Example) |
Type | CodeableConcept |
Summary | true |
OccupationalData.pastOrPresentJob.jobDuty | |
Element Id | OccupationalData.pastOrPresentJob.jobDuty |
Definition | A regular action performed at a single job. |
Control | 0..* |
Type | string |
Summary | true |
OccupationalData.pastOrPresentJob.occupationalHazard | |
Element Id | OccupationalData.pastOrPresentJob.occupationalHazard |
Definition | A hazard that is specific to a person's work or work environment for a single job and with which the person might come in contact. A hazard is a source of potential harm to an individual's physical or mental health (e.g., biological, chemical, physical, psychological, radiological). |
Control | 0..* |
Type | string |
Summary | true |
OccupationalData.pastOrPresentJob.workSchedule | |
Element Id | OccupationalData.pastOrPresentJob.workSchedule |
Definition | Describes a person's typical arrangement of working hours for one job. |
Control | 0..1 |
Summary | true |
OccupationalData.pastOrPresentJob.workSchedule.code | |
Element Id | OccupationalData.pastOrPresentJob.workSchedule.code |
Definition | A code that represents a person's typical arrangement of working hours for one job. |
Control | 1..1 |
Terminology Binding | Work Schedule (ODH) (Example) |
Type | CodeableConcept |
Summary | true |
OccupationalData.pastOrPresentJob.workSchedule.weeklyWorkDays | |
Element Id | OccupationalData.pastOrPresentJob.workSchedule.weeklyWorkDays |
Definition | The typical number of days worked in a week by a person at one job. |
Control | 0..1 |
Type | decimal |
Summary | true |
OccupationalData.pastOrPresentJob.workSchedule.dailyWorkHours | |
Element Id | OccupationalData.pastOrPresentJob.workSchedule.dailyWorkHours |
Definition | The number of hours worked in a day or shift at one job by a person. For those working a split shift (divided into two parts that are separated by an interval longer than a normal rest period), it is the total of both periods of time in a shift. |
Control | 0..1 |
Type | decimal |
Summary | true |